highflame-ai/ramparts
mcp scan that scans any mcp server for indirect attack vectors and security or configuration vulnerabilities
This tool helps developers and security professionals identify vulnerabilities in their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ers. It takes an MCP server endpoint or configuration file as input and outputs a detailed report highlighting potential security risks like data exfiltration or command injection. Security auditors, AI developers, and anyone deploying AI agents that use MCP servers would use this to ensure secure operations.
Use this if you need to perform a security audit of your MCP servers or integrate automated security scanning into your development and deployment workflows for AI agent systems.
Not ideal if you need comprehensive runtime security monitoring or general web application security scanning, as Ramparts focuses specifically on MCP server metadata and static configurations.
